What is Google's Net Worth in 2019? Let's Find Out

In 2019, Google was a dominant force in digital advertising and cloud infrastructure, driving substantial revenue and profit growth. Understanding Google's net worth in 2019 requires looking at market capitalization, cash reserves, debts, and strategic investments.

Below is a detailed snapshot of Google's financial position in 2019, followed by thematic sections that explore market valuation, profitability, enterprise value, and user impact.

Metric 2019 Value Unit Notes
Market Capitalization 1,010 Billion USD Share price multiplied by outstanding shares
Total Shareholders' Equity 223.2 Billion USD Book value reported in annual balance sheet
Net Debt -51.2 Billion USD Cash and investments exceeded debt
Enterprise Value 947.5 Billion USD Market cap plus debt minus cash
Annual Revenue 161.9 Billion USD Total sales for the fiscal year

Market Valuation in 2019

Google's market capitalization in 2019 reflected investor confidence in its advertising platforms and growing cloud business. Shares traded above book value, emphasizing intangible assets such as brand strength and proprietary algorithms. The company's vast cash flow enabled share buybacks and strategic acquisitions.

Profitability and Cash Generation

Google generated robust operating income in 2019, driven by high-margin search and YouTube advertising. Strong free cash flow allowed significant investments in research, infrastructure, and shareholder returns. This performance supported the premium valuation assigned to the stock.

FAQ

Reader questions

How is Google's net worth different from its market capitalization in 2019?

Market capitalization reflects the total equity value based on share price, while net worth typically refers to shareholders' equity on the balance sheet. In 2019, Google's market cap was significantly higher than its book equity due to intangible assets and growth expectations.

What was Google's enterprise value in 2019 and why does it matter?

Google's enterprise value in 2019 was approximately 947.5 billion USD, accounting for market cap, debt, and cash. This metric is important for assessing the cost of acquiring the entire business and comparing companies with different capital structures.

Did Google have net debt in 2019?

No, Google maintained a negative net debt of about 51.2 billion USD in 2019, indicating that cash and investments exceeded interest-bearing debt. This strong liquidity provided flexibility for acquisitions, dividends, and strategic initiatives.

How did 2019 revenue support Google's valuation?

With 161.9 billion USD in annual revenue, Google generated substantial earnings and cash flow. High-margin advertising and expanding cloud contracts underpinned the premium valuation and justified ongoing investments in innovation.
